Access Franklin County’s rich 19th-century history online
This website offers a digital transcription of a comprehensive 19th-century history book focused on Franklin County and surrounding areas in Massachusetts. You can explore detailed town histories, learn about early settlers, local geography, and historical events including military and church histories. It’s a great resource if you’re interested in local history or genealogy.
The site is designed for people who want an easy way to read and research historical content online without needing physical copies. Each town page provides focused information, making it simple to find specific details about the area.
